got a question our pup will be between flights for 2 hours. Does someone take the pups out for pee breaks or are they left all that time. Am I gong to have a pee pee puppy me when we get her ?it is another 2 hours drive home.
Three more sleeps to go. :cheer:
The airlines here are required to leave them in their crates. I think Canada is the same.
Australia is the same, no opening the crates for security of the dogs and that they don't get out on stop overs. They do top the water up though & make sure they are OK.

He'll be fine. :D

Brie came in from overseas and hours getting all the paper work through customs, plus the flight from another country and the holding there before the flight left that country after finalisation of the paper work on that side, but the guys in the cargo holding area on both sides when they left and when they arrived where great with her and her brother. Nice shady cool area as it was a stifling hot day here when they landed and they topped up their water when needed through the wire door of the crate, there not allowed to open the door at all, two puppers in a large flying crate.. :D They actually did not want them to go and kept saying do you really want them, we wanna keep them. 8O :lol:
